Abstract     
Testudo graeca kleinmanni Testudinidae (9 localities), Binghazi (10) and Sabha (11), and on four adjacent localities in Tunisia. We recorded two species of frogs and 25 species of reptiles: two species of turtles, two agamids, one chamaeleonid, seven species of geckos, four species of lacertids, three species of scincids, four species of colubrids and two species of viperids. Records of Agama impalearis Boettger, 1874 and Tarentola neglecta Strauch, 1895 extend the known ranges of these species. Material of some taxonomically difficult taxa, i. e., Acanthodactylus scutellatus (Audouin, 1809) group, genera Stenodactylus Fitzinger, 1826 and Tarentola Gray, 1825, is discussed.
